Transaction 501714d332c8abd18886c4f8c34d3033d61d1275fc69dd40cc2129e0a70a0f03
1 Input
1 Output
-
501714d332c8abd18886c4f8c34d3033d61d1275fc69dd40cc2129e0a70a0f03:0
- value
- 689928
- script pubkey
- OP_0 OP_PUSHBYTES_20 c81aa56bfed86d5d0396f93e5ba0604ec06580e7
- address
- bc1qeqd226l7mpk46quklyl9hgrqfmqxtq88t8jrnk